Description / Bauer FLEX PRACTICE Youth Practise Jersey
Bauer FLEX PRACTICE Youth Practice Jersey is a lightweight hockey jersey for children who need a comfortable top for practices, team sessions and regular time on the ice. It is made to be worn over protective gear, so the fit gives enough room for shoulder pads and elbow pads without making the jersey feel heavy. The polyester flat back mesh fabric helps keep the jersey light and easy to move in during skating, passing and shooting drills. With reinforced stitching and a crossover interlock collar, it is a practical choice for young players, teams and training groups.
Material: 100% polyester flat back mesh gives the jersey a light and breathable feel for regular hockey use.
Fabric Weight: 170 g/m² mesh fabric offers a good balance between lightness and durability for practices and team sessions.
Fit: The Youth hockey cut leaves room for protective equipment while still allowing children to move freely on the ice.
Collar: The crossover interlock collar gives the jersey a clean hockey look and helps it sit comfortably around the neck.
Durability: Reinforced stitching helps the jersey handle regular training, repeated movement and frequent use.
Team Details: The simple design works well for team colours, numbers and logos. It is useful for clubs, practice groups and training sets.
Use: Bauer FLEX PRACTICE Youth Practice Jersey is made for young players who need a light, easy-to-wear jersey for hockey practices, team drills and occasional game use.
